Friends of the Harrison Library Present Andrew Gross on March 28 who will talk about his book EYES WIDE OPEN as well as his new book 15 SECONDS

Celebrate Andrew Gross at the Harrison Library, Wednesday, March 28, 2012 at 7:00pm. 

 

Friends of the Harrison Public Library, Bruce Avenue, welcome Andrew Gross.

The bestselling author, and Purchase resident, talks about his book “Eyes Wide Open,” his most personal book yet, a gripping novel based on two real-life experiences - the tragic loss of his nephew and a chance encounter years before with the nation’s most notorious cult killer.

Andrew will also talk about his new book coming out in July - a wild tale of an event from one of his book tours gone crazily wrong - “15 Seconds” is a story of how even the best of lives can change in just an instant – and of an innocent man, framed for murder, who has to save the person he loves the most, and who cannot go to the police to clear his name.

 

Andrew Gross is the author of the New York Times and international bestsellers “Blue Zone,” “Don’t Look Twice,” “Reckless,” and “Dark Tide.”  He is also co-author of several number one bestsellers with James Patterson, including “Judge & Jury” and “Lifeguard.”  Books will be available for purchase and signing.
